Output 59830b7e65786d2b620938d8bc7146d3f3a4fcdd34f4968e37c39fbee2119f21:0

value
1082800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f1379a5d68f6bd516b17c7bcae61784f475718 OP_EQUAL
address
384qWqxQsyYY6hEUJX88co9NAW4zYdbZxk
transaction
59830b7e65786d2b620938d8bc7146d3f3a4fcdd34f4968e37c39fbee2119f21
confirmations
158631
spent
true